Output 3d5d123c2f39edb4c812dacfc61ba5d7281c2177a591e763ef8f5a268a7dee74:3

value
3020589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 657cd2454001f493266a4ab0b8f7494f210bc1b4 OP_EQUAL
address
3AwdhfCURxwZ1gUem8D1nC2Y8xKRwvLbg5
transaction
3d5d123c2f39edb4c812dacfc61ba5d7281c2177a591e763ef8f5a268a7dee74
confirmations
272499
spent
true